Market Overview: Growth and Key Trends

The Irish online casino market has witnessed substantial expansion in recent years. This growth is fuelled by several factors, including increasing internet penetration, the widespread adoption of mobile devices, and the convenience and accessibility of online platforms. The market encompasses a wide range of products, including slots, table games (blackjack, roulette, poker), live dealer games, and sports betting. Key trends shaping the market include:

  • Mobile Gaming Dominance: Mobile devices are the primary platform for online casino gaming in Ireland. Operators are prioritizing mobile-first strategies, optimizing their platforms for smaller screens and offering dedicated mobile apps.
  • Live Dealer Games: Live dealer games, which stream real-time casino action with human dealers, are growing in popularity. They offer an immersive and interactive experience, replicating the atmosphere of a land-based casino.
  • Game Innovation: Software developers are continuously innovating, introducing new game mechanics, themes, and features to attract and retain players. This includes incorporating elements of gamification, such as leaderboards and rewards programs.
  • Increased Regulation: The Irish government is actively working to regulate the online gambling sector, which will impact market dynamics and operator strategies.

Regulatory Landscape: Navigating the Rules

The regulatory environment in Ireland is undergoing significant changes. The government is committed to establishing a comprehensive regulatory framework for online gambling, with the aim of protecting consumers, preventing problem gambling, and ensuring fair play. Key aspects of the regulatory landscape include:

  • The Gambling Regulation Bill: This bill aims to modernize gambling legislation and establish a new regulatory body, the Gambling Regulatory Authority of Ireland.
  • Licensing Requirements: The new legislation will introduce a licensing system for online gambling operators, requiring them to meet specific standards and comply with regulations.
  • Advertising Restrictions: The government is likely to implement stricter advertising regulations, including limitations on the types of promotions that can be offered and the targeting of vulnerable groups.
  • Player Protection Measures: The regulatory framework will emphasize player protection measures, such as age verification, responsible gambling tools (deposit limits, self-exclusion), and the prevention of money laundering.
  • Taxation: The government is expected to introduce a tax regime for online gambling operators, generating revenue for the state.

Navigating this complex regulatory landscape requires operators to stay informed, adapt their strategies, and ensure compliance with all applicable laws and regulations.
